*,*:before,*:after{box-sizing:border-box;margin:0;padding:0}body{font-family:sans-serif;background:#fff}.panel{padding:2rem 2rem 1rem;display:flex;flex-direction:column;gap:1.5rem;background:#fff}.panel-subtitle{font-size:.85rem;color:#999;text-align:center;margin-top:-1rem;font-style:italic}.panel-title{font-size:1.5rem;font-weight:600;color:#222;text-align:center}.charts-row{display:flex;gap:1.5rem;flex:1}.chart-card{flex:1;background:#fff;border-radius:8px;box-shadow:0 2px 8px #00000014;padding:1.25rem 1.5rem .75rem;display:flex;flex-direction:column;gap:.5rem}.chart-header{display:flex;align-items:center;justify-content:space-between;gap:1rem}.chart-title{font-size:1rem;font-weight:600;color:#333;margin:0}.range-selector{display:flex;gap:.25rem}.range-btn{padding:.2rem .6rem;border:1px solid #ddd;border-radius:4px;background:#fff;font-size:.75rem;color:#666;cursor:pointer;transition:all .15s}.range-btn:hover{border-color:#aaa;color:#333}.range-btn.active{background:#333;border-color:#333;color:#fff}.chart-state{display:flex;align-items:center;justify-content:center;height:380px;color:#888;font-size:.9rem}.chart-state.error{color:#c00}.chart-unit{font-size:.75rem;color:#aaa;margin:0}.chart-unit a{color:#aaa;text-decoration:underline}.chart-unit a:hover{color:#666}.indicators{display:flex;justify-content:center;gap:2rem;padding:.5rem 0}.indicator{display:flex;flex-direction:column;align-items:center;gap:.2rem}.indicator-value{font-size:1.1rem;font-weight:700;color:#222}.indicator-value.up{color:#e03b2e}.indicator-value.down{color:#1aa86e}.indicator-label{font-size:.7rem;color:#999;text-transform:uppercase;letter-spacing:.03em}.chart-tooltip{background:#fff;border:1px solid #e5e5e5;border-radius:6px;padding:.5rem .75rem;box-shadow:0 2px 8px #0000001a}.tooltip-date{font-size:.75rem;color:#888;margin:0 0 .2rem}.tooltip-value{font-size:.9rem;font-weight:600;color:#222;margin:0}@media(max-width:768px){.charts-row{flex-direction:column}}
